Performing Thorough Case Investigations



To properly represent your customers, conduct an extensive examination of the instance. This is critical in constructing a strong defense technique and uncovering any type of proof that could support your customer's innocence or reduce their costs.

Start by examining all offered papers, such as authorities reports, witness statements, and forensic records. Meeting witnesses, both the prosecution's and your very own, to collect extra details or determine variances.

Go to the crime scene to get a far better understanding of the situations surrounding the case. Consult with professionals, such as forensic specialists or private investigators, to aid in assessing proof or finding potential witnesses.

Furthermore, discover any kind of potential legal issues or constitutional offenses that can affect the instance. By performing a detailed investigation, you can reveal critical details and develop an engaging protection technique that offers your customer the best opportunity at a beneficial end result.

Preventing Typical Errors in Trial Prep Work



To avoid usual mistakes in test prep work, you should carefully examine all pertinent situation documents and speak with experts in order to build a strong defense strategy. By doing so, you can make certain that you're well-prepared and outfitted to successfully represent your customer in court.

Below are some important steps to follow:

- Thoroughly examine all the evidence: Put in the time to assess every item of evidence, including police reports, witness statements, and forensic reports. This will assist you recognize any type of inconsistencies or weak points in the prosecution's situation.

- Seek experienced point of views: Speak with specialists in relevant fields such as forensic scientific research, psychology, or innovation. Their understandings and opinions can be very useful in challenging the prosecution's proof or offering alternative descriptions.

- Expect the opposing disagreements: Analyze the prosecution's instance and expect their debates. This will certainly permit you to create counterarguments and strengthen your defense method.

Navigating the Obstacles of Cross-Examination



When cross-examining witnesses, you have to be prepared to deal with numerous difficulties and effectively navigate them to reinforce your instance. Interrogation can be a defining moment in a trial, as it enables you to test the credibility and reliability of the witness's statement.

One difficulty you may come across is a hostile witness who's uncooperative or combative. In such a circumstance, it's important to preserve your calmness and remain focused on the truths.

One more challenge is handling evasive witnesses who attempt to avoid addressing your inquiries directly. To overcome this, you can reword your concerns or present contradictory evidence to collar the witness.

Additionally, you might encounter objections from the rival guidance throughout interrogation. It's important to expect potential objections and be prepared with persuasive debates to counter them.
